HAVI is a global, privately owned company focused on innovating,
optimizing and managing the supply chains of leading brands.
Offering services in marketing analytics, packaging, supply chain
management and logistics, HAVI partners with companies to address
challenges big and small across the supply chain, from commodity to
customer. Founded in 1974, HAVI employs more than 10,000 people and
serves customers in more than 100 countries. HAVI's supply chain
services are complemented by the customer engagement services
offered by our affiliated company The Marketing Store. For more
information, please visit HAVI.com.
